US12332040 - Ordnance disarming device

ordnancedisarmingfirearm
The patent describes an ordnance disarming device featuring a self-centering inner barrel and an outer barrel, designed to expel a projectile for disarming purposes. It includes a receiver/breech cap that functions as a muzzle brake and operates effectively in extreme temperatures without the need for O-rings.
